Lackland Independent School District is a public independent school district (ISD) based in Bexar County, Texas, United States. [ 1 ] The district's boundaries are coterminous with Lackland Air Force Base (AFB), [ 1 ] and it only draws students who reside within the installation.

Randolph Field ISD is one of three school districts in the state whose boundaries are coterminous with a military installation; the other two (also in the San Antonio area) are Lackland ISD and Fort Sam Houston ISD. Founded in 1932, it was the first school district in Texas to serve a military installation.

An independent school district (ISD) is a type of school district in some US states for primary and secondary education that operates as an entity independent and separate from any municipality or county, and only under the oversight of the respective state government.

San Antonio Independent School District is a school district based in San Antonio, Texas, United States. [2] San Antonio ISD ranks as the 13th largest of Texas' 1,057 school districts. [3] The District encompasses 79 square miles with a total population of 306,943 (2010 U.S. Census).
